Got one of these refurbished a few years back as per previous poster. Still working, that one came with a 4ah battery.

They are lightweight and given my small property works well for trimming and edging.

One thing people don't like is the small spool and the line is very thin. I buy different braided line and wind my own line. Also there is only one line to cut the grass as opposed to the double ended ones. Motor is ok but may struggle in thick grass/weeds.

One the plus side I like the easy feed without having to bump the end. Since it has wheels, edging is easy once you figure how to rotate the head. Expands in length and has an adjustable head and trimming guard. I also have an adapter that takes Ryobi batteries so saves me buying Worx specific ones.

I bought this at the $43 sale price. I like it. Much better design to turn back and forth from trimmer to edger than the Ryobi versions. These are unlocked and turned in the middle of the pole. Ryobi has a stupid foot release method near the head. That's fine initially. But since it's where the action is, grass clippings and dirt get into the turn crevice and jam things up.

I agree with another commenter that the spool is small and the included line is too thin. I already rewrapped with .80
